im即时通信API支持多语言支持吗?

随着互联网技术的不断发展,即时通信(IM)已经成为人们日常生活中不可或缺的一部分。无论是工作、学习还是生活,IM都极大地提高了人们的沟通效率。为了满足不同用户的需求,许多即时通信API都提供了多语言支持。本文将围绕“im即时通信API支持多语言支持吗?”这个问题,对IM多语言支持的相关知识进行详细介绍。

一、IM即时通信API概述

IM即时通信API是指一套提供即时通信功能的接口,开发者可以通过调用这些接口,实现即时消息、语音、视频等功能。IM即时通信API广泛应用于各种社交平台、企业通讯工具、在线教育等领域。

二、IM即时通信API多语言支持的重要性

  1. 扩大用户群体:随着全球化的推进,越来越多的企业和个人需要使用IM工具进行跨语言沟通。提供多语言支持可以吸引更多用户,扩大用户群体。

  2. 提高用户体验:不同用户对语言的偏好不同,提供多语言支持可以让用户在使用IM工具时,感受到更加便捷和舒适。

  3. 增强国际化竞争力:在全球化竞争日益激烈的今天,提供多语言支持的IM即时通信API可以提升企业的国际化竞争力。

三、IM即时通信API多语言支持现状

目前,许多IM即时通信API都提供了多语言支持,以下是一些常见的IM即时通信API及其多语言支持情况:

  1. WhatsApp API:支持多种语言,包括英语、西班牙语、法语、德语等。

  2. Facebook Messenger API:支持多种语言,包括英语、西班牙语、法语、德语等。

  3. Telegram API:支持多种语言,包括英语、俄语、土耳其语、越南语等。

  4. WeChat API:支持多种语言,包括英语、日语、韩语、泰语等。

  5. Slack API:支持多种语言,包括英语、西班牙语、法语、德语等。

四、实现IM即时通信API多语言支持的方法

  1. 国际化设计:在设计IM即时通信API时,应考虑国际化需求,如字符编码、日期格式、货币单位等。

  2. 语言包:将API文档、接口参数、错误信息等翻译成多种语言,形成语言包。在调用API时,根据用户选择的语言加载相应的语言包。

  3. 翻译API:利用第三方翻译API,将用户输入的消息、API调用结果等翻译成目标语言。

  4. 本地化适配:针对不同地区的用户需求,对IM即时通信API进行本地化适配,如添加地区特色功能、调整界面布局等。

五、总结

IM即时通信API的多语言支持对于满足不同用户的需求、提高用户体验、增强国际化竞争力具有重要意义。目前,许多IM即时通信API都提供了多语言支持,开发者可以根据实际需求选择合适的API,并采取相应的实现方法,为用户提供优质的即时通信服务。

猜你喜欢:多人音视频会议